The Nextlander Podcast 019: Across the Shyamalaniverse

This humdinger of an ep features a long chat about Metroid Dread (and Switch emulation), thoughts on our time with Sable and Back 4 Blood, more on Jett and the Outer Wilds DLC, and discussion of the four-day game dev work week, the right to repair Xboxes, EA's FIFA faceoff, the future of Ryu Ga Gotoku Studio, and more!
